After celebrating its return to the off-road and motocross markets in early 2010 with the release of its thermoplastic resin MT-X helmet, AGV expands its off-road products family with 2 new helmets. First is the high-end AX-8, with its carbon-Kevlar-fiber shell. Developed over the past 2 years in close collaboration with AGV’s team of pro riders on both sides of the Atlantic, including American X Games and Supercross stars Travis Pastrana and Davi Millsaps and European Motocross, Enduro and Supermotard champs like David Philippaerts, Deny Philippaerts, Gautier Paulin, the AX-8 brings AGV back into the world of dirt with an original design and highly technical characteristics.

The design is pure AGV style with an evident family feeling in the shape of its shell and the front air vents and rear extractors that show influence from AGV’s road racing helmets and the MT-X. For the shell construction AGV used and SSL layering made of carbon, Kevlar and fiberglass in order to keep the weight low while ensuring the maximum safety. The AX-8 comes in 3 shell sizes which, combine with various inner liner combination of cheek-pads and crown-pads allow for a size run ranging XXS to XXXL. The helmet weighs at an average of 1.350g and is certified DOT/ECE2205 for the US market.

The other new arrival in the AGV family is an adventure, dual-sport, helmet, the AX-8 Dual. Based on the AX-8 shell, this extremely versatile helmet is designed for the growing adventure touring segment with an on-road and-off road use. To the strong safety and comfort characteristics of its motocross cousin, specific technical features have been added to the AX-8 Dual. The added features include the shield and its specific fully opening mechanism, the opening chin vents as well as an additional opening air-intake on the top of the helmet.

The integrated IVS ventilation system receives the addition of an air-intake on top of the helmet with an open/close position as well as a chin guard vent – which can be easily removed without the use of tools – with an open/closed mechanism for adjustment of the airflow inside the helmet. The AX-8 Dual comes with a new AGV Flat Dual shield in non-scratch, anti-fog, polycarbonate and has a specific mechanism that offers gradual shield opening. The AX-8 Dual visor has been designed to reduce the sail-effect during travel to a minimum.

The helmet can be configured in 3 different set-ups:
1. Supermotard/Adventure Touring – with visor and shield.
2. Off-Road – with visor and no shield.
3. Street/Naked Bikes – with shield and no visor.
